    I think Squid is better than other writing applications because the interface is very intuitive and consists of only the tools needed to take notes.

    However, there is an inconvenience after using it for about a month. That's when I change the tool. It is very inconvenient for me to press the tool button every time when I change the pen to highlighter or eraser, or when I change their color.
    In conclusion, what I want is an interface where the tools are shown side by side in a row. I want to be able to change the tool to one touch when I take notes. Instead, the user can make detailed changes (color, bold, pressure, transparency, etc.) if the user is touching the pen long enough. Like Samsung Note in Android application.
